Description
The Walled Garden at Newick Park is a Grade II listed structure that dates back to the 18th century. This former walled garden, which served as an independent nursery at the time of the survey, features a square design with gabled walls that slope down a south-facing hillside, maximizing sunlight exposure. The brick walls are notable for their unusual bond pattern, consisting of one row of stretchers followed by a row of alternate headers and stretchers. The walls stand approximately 12 feet high and include cambered central entrances. Additional architectural features include curved brick coping, corner piers with stone coping, and some brick buttresses.
